Learn to Name What You're Feeling

One of the most powerful tools for working with energy is emotional clarity. Vague unease is hard to work with. But when you can name what you're feeling — anxiety, grief, frustration, resentment — you're suddenly able to address it directly.

Here's why this matters for frequency: each emotion has a specific energetic signature. Practically speaking, when you can name what you're feeling, you can work with that energy instead of being consumed by it. You can ask: where is this in my body? What does it need? What would help it move?

Breathwork is underrated. Conscious breathing — especially slow, extended exhales — activates the parasympathetic nervous system and raises your vibrational state. You don't need to do anything fancy. Just breathe deeply and slowly, focusing on making your exhale longer than your inhale.
